Connected Motorcycle Market Definition and Overview
Connected Motorcycle Market Industry integrate advanced communication systems that enable real-time data exchange between the rider, the motorcycle, and the surrounding environment. This connectivity facilitates a range of functionalities, including navigation assistance, vehicle diagnostics, emergency calling, and infotainment services. By leveraging technologies such as cellular networks and dedicated short-range communications (DSRC), connected motorcycles enhance rider safety, comfort, and overall riding experience.

Connected Motorcycle Market Growth Drivers and Opportunities
Several key factors are propelling the expansion of the connected motorcycle market:
-
Increased Demand for Rider Safety and Assistance Systems: The rising concern for rider safety has led to the adoption of adv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) in motorcycles. Features such as collision alerts, lane departure warnings, and automatic emergency calls contribute to reducing accidents and enhancing rider security.
-
Technological Advancements in Connectivity Solutions: The integration of Internet of Things (IoT) devices and advancements in 5G technology have enabled seamless communication between vehicles and infrastructure. This connectivity supports real-time traffic updates, remote diagnostics, and over-the-air software updates, improving the overall functionality of connected motorcycles.
-
Growing Popularity of Infotainment Systems: Riders are increasingly seeking enhanced riding experiences through infotainment systems that offer navigation, music streaming, and hands-free communication. The demand for such features is driving manufacturers to incorporate sophisticated infotainment solutions into their motorcycle models.
-
Regulatory Initiatives for Vehicle Safety: Governments and regulatory bodies worldwide are implementing stringent safety regulations, encouraging the adoption of connected technologies in motorcycles to improve road safety and reduce fatalities.
-
Emergence of Electric Motorcycles: The shift towards electric vehicles (EVs) has opened new avenues for connected technologies. Electric motorcycles often come equipped with advanced connectivity features to monitor battery status, optimize energy consumption, and provide route planning based on charging station locations.

Segmentation Analysis
The connected motorcycle market can be comprehensively analyzed through its segmentation by service, hardware, end-user, and region.
1. By Service:
-
Driver Assistance: Services that aid the rider in navigation, collision avoidance, and adaptive cruise control, enhancing safety and convenience.
-
Infotainment: Entertainment and information services, including music streaming, call management, and access to social media platforms, providing an enriched riding experience.
-
Safety: Features such as emergency calling (eCall), breakdown assistance, and stolen vehicle tracking that prioritize rider security.
-
Vehicle Management: Remote diagnostics, vehicle health monitoring, and maintenance alerts that assist in the upkeep and performance optimization of the motorcycle.
-
Insurance: Usage-based insurance services that utilize telematics data to assess rider behavior and customize insurance premiums accordingly.
2. By Hardware:
-
Embedded: Permanently integrated hardware within the motorcycle that facilitates connectivity and data exchange.
-
Tethered: Systems that rely on external devices, such as smartphones, to provide connectivity features.
-
Integrated: A combination of embedded and tethered systems, offering flexibility in connectivity options.
3. By End-User:
-
Private Users: Individual riders who utilize connected features for personal convenience, safety, and entertainment.
-
Commercial Users: Businesses and fleet operators who employ connected motorcycles for delivery services, rentals, and other commercial purposes, benefiting from fleet management and tracking capabilities.

Competitive Landscape
The connected motorcycle market is characterized by the presence of several key players focusing on technological innovation, strategic partnerships, and expanding their product portfolios to gain a competitive edge. Notable companies include:
-
BMW Motorrad: A pioneer in integrating connectivity features, offering services like BMW ConnectedRide, which provides real-time traffic information, navigation, and emergency call functions.
-
Harley-Davidson: Incorporating advanced infotainment systems and smartphone connectivity in their models to enhance the rider experience.
-
Honda Motor Co., Ltd.: Developing connected technologies focused on safety and navigation, including the Honda RoadSync system that allows riders to control smartphone functions via voice commands.
-
Kawasaki Heavy Industries, Ltd.: Exploring AI integration and rideology applications to provide riders with personalized information and vehicle status updates.
-
Yamaha Motor Co., Ltd.: Offering connectivity features through the Yamaha MyRide app, enabling riders to track and share their riding experiences.
